How Lewis Hamilton and Kim Kardashian Went From Rumor to Real
Super Bowl LX: the first public outing
February 8, 2026, became the first real marker of something serious. Hamilton and Kardashian appeared together at Super Bowl LX, and insiders told Entertainment Tonight the pair were "exploring a romantic relationship." Their social overlap runs deep: shared celebrity circles, Hamilton's producer credit on the F1 film starring Brad Pitt, and his growing presence in American culture far beyond racing. The Super Bowl outing was the moment the press went from asking questions to making calls.
The Instagram Hard-Launch and the April Moments That Removed All Doubt
March 2026: going Instagram official
Kim moved the story forward on Instagram in March, with no statement, no press release, and no spokesperson. Just the post. That post is widely considered the moment the two went fully public.
April escalation: Coachella, shopping, and the carousel that confirmed everything
April moved fast. On April 11, they were spotted together at Coachella in Indio, California, during Justin Bieber's set. A shopping date in Los Angeles followed on April 14. Then on April 16, Kardashian posted an Instagram photo of herself sitting on Hamilton's lap. No caption. The image did all the work. Neither camp has issued a formal statement at any point in this timeline. The Instagram activity has been the entire public record, and that approach appears entirely intentional.
Lewis Hamilton & Kim Kardashian: Malibu, Oxfordshire, and the Kendall Question
April 20: the Malibu moment that went global
Per E! News and TMZ coverage published April 22, 2026, Lewis Hamilton and Kim Kardashian spent April 20 at a Malibu beach, where they were photographed kissing in the ocean, swimming together, and sharing what appeared to be a surfing lesson. The images moved the story from celebrity gossip into a full global news cycle within hours. A recent F1 schedule pause had given Hamilton an extended window in California, which explains the timing of the Malibu day and the weeks of reported sightings that preceded it.
A reported £120,000 UK romantic getaway and what it signals
The Sun reported that Hamilton arranged a private flight from Los Angeles to England for the two of them, with the couple staying at a luxury hotel in Witney, Oxfordshire. According to that report, the stay included a full spa buyout, a couples massage, and three bodyguards on site, with a total cost of approximately £120,000. The Sun's reporting has not been independently verified.
Separately, Page Six reported that Hamilton called Kendall Jenner ahead of the UK trip to inform her about the relationship before it became public in the British press, a claim that has not been confirmed by either party's representatives. If accurate, it would say something about how seriously he is approaching this.
On the family side: Kim has four children with ex-husband Kanye West, whose divorce was finalized in 2022. North is 12, Saint is 10, Chicago is 8, and Psalm is 6. No reports have surfaced yet of any introduction between Hamilton and the children.

His 2026 Ferrari chapter is the story worth staying for
Hamilton left Mercedes after 12 years to join Ferrari for 2026, chasing an eighth world championship that would surpass Michael Schumacher's all-time record. The challenge is genuine. Ferrari is currently working through a significant battery performance deficit against a dominant Mercedes this season, with Kimi Antonelli leading the championship on 72 points and George Russell second on 63.
